How does a program project manager balance stakeholder expectations across multiple projects?

Program Project Managers often manage several projects simultaneously, each with its own set of stakeholders and priorities. Balancing these expectations requires clear communication, regular status updates, and the ability to negotiate resource allocation to meet competing needs. They frequently facilitate meetings to align goals, address risks early, and ensure transparency among teams. Building strong relationships and setting realistic timelines are key strategies to successfully manage stakeholder expectations across the program.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a program project man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Program Project Manager, you need strong project management expertise, organizational skills, and a relevant degree or certification such as PMP or PRINCE2. Familiarity with project management tools like Microsoft Project, Jira, or Asana, as well as budget tracking systems, is typically required. Excellent leadership, communication, and problem-solving skills help you coordinate teams, manage stakeholders, and navigate challenges. These abilities are essential for delivering projects on time, within scope, and aligned with organizational goals.

The Program Project Manager typically oversees multiple related projects, focusing on strategic alignment and program outcomes, often requiring certifications like PMP or PgMP. In contrast, a Project Coordinator provides administrative support within individual projects, assisting with scheduling, documentation, and communication. Understanding these differences helps clarify career paths and role expectations in project management.
